Output 628c60c49e055df5ab5f497c71b60a170e1f62536554b0b9c3db6a4a840b40a6:0

value
24836603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e6eab6951663c6d8a86e35ece22bb6ed103ab65 OP_EQUAL
address
38qjCxqKbpzyQCKYqHCynWb6eJmCHVgbb2
transaction
628c60c49e055df5ab5f497c71b60a170e1f62536554b0b9c3db6a4a840b40a6
spent
true